%S A002827 6,60,90,87360,146361946186458562560000
%N A002827 Unitary perfect numbers: usigma(n)-n = n.
%C A002827 d is a unitary divisor of n if gcd(d,n/d)=1; usigma(n) is their sum (A034448).
%C A002827 The prime factors of a unitary perfect number (A002827) are the Higgs 
               primes (A057447). - Paul Muljadi (paulmuljadi(AT)yahoo.com), Oct 
               10 2005

%e A002827 Unitary divisors of 60 are 1,4,3,5,12,20,15,60, with sum 120 = 2*60.
%e A002827 146361946186458562560000 = 2^18 * 3 * 5^4 * 7 * 11 * 13 * 19 * 37 * 79 
               * 109 * 157 * 313
